Full Power Rack
The multipurpose full power rack is used as heavy duty gym equipment. It helps to do squats, bench presses, pull-ups and is also used as a dip station.
Figure 2: Power Rack
Multipower rack holds considerable space in the gym, which is a piece of multi exercises.
Cable Crossover Smith Machine
Very smart heavy duty equipment; a smith machine is used as upper portion body exercises. Two columns have bearings on each side with a pulley system connected to a cable crossover.
Figure 3: Smith Machine
Good gyms have two or more smith machines which render both advanced and beginners as fitness trainees.
Hammer Strength Machine
Well-designed commercial gyms usually have a hammer strength machine set up. This is bodily aligned heavy duty gym equipment.
Figure 4: Hammer Strength Machine
Hammer strength machines are suitable to increase shoulder and arm strengths with both two and one-sided bodily movement.
Chest Press Machine
To build chest muscles, chest press machines are very popular among heavy duty gym equipment.
Figure 5: Chest Press Machine
The design is a bit different but works as a bench press machine to build pectoral muscles.
Lat Pull-down Machines
A very effective heavy duty gym equipment to build both back and chest muscles are a lat pull-down machine.
Figure 6: Lat Pulldown
It comes with a barbell with weights or a weight stack connected to the pull-up with the support of the attached pulley system. Your gym must have a lat pull-down machine for effective weight training.
Leg Press Machine
The leg press is used to hit the leg muscles to build your strength to take more weights and increase stamina.
Figure 7: Leg Press Machine
Both inclined and straight positions are used to hit leg muscles by pushing the weight stacks.
Leg Extension Machine
The front thigh muscles, quadriceps are hit by a leg extension machine.
Figure 8: Leg Extension Machine
Leg extensions as a heavy duty gym machine help build your thigh muscle, develop size and increase thigh strength.
Treadmills
To run or to walk with the speed limit, digital treadmills are effective for cardio development.
Figure 9: Treadmills
From the local gym to home gym, treadmills are a much affordable option for cardio. It works with a rotating belt with the help of a motor. Before buying a treadmill, the specifications and durability must be checked.

How is heavy duty gym equipment different from home gym equipment?
Commercial gym equipment is usually heavy duty gym equipment that is more expensive and costly to set up. On the other hand, home gym equipment is less costly with more availability from local stores.
Please have a clear understanding of the differences between heavy duty gym equipment and home gym equipment.
Heavy Duty Gym Equipment | Home Gym Equipment |
The commercial heavy duty gym machines are more durable. This is to be used by more and more people. | Home gym equipment is used by family members or less used comparatively. |
For durability and more uses, heavy duty equipment cost is high. | Less costly but durable used less frequently. |
Heavy duty gym equipment is suitable for a commercial gym that needs more space and maintenance. | Home gym equipment needs little space and less maintenance. |
Is heavy duty gym equipment a better option for your gym?
Yes, heavy duty gym equipment is a must for the commercial gym setup.
A commercial gym has lots of people using the gym equipment regularly and very frequently. The gym owners should ensure the durability and sustainability of the machines. This will minimize the cost of buying the same machines just after some use or repeatedly damaged.
Heavy duty gym machines are very durable, though costly. These are more technologically sound and with more effectiveness for exercises.
Also, weight training to the advanced level fitness trainees needs to have heavy duty equipment in the gym.

How to maintain heavy duty gym equipment?
All the gym equipment needs to be appropriately cleaned and disinfected after use regularly.
Along with the machines for cardio and the weights, the counter, check-in places, fresh-rooms, and other places and materials that come under human touch need proper cleaning.
Figure 11: Gym Equipment maintenance
So, proper maintenance, including cleanliness and fine-tuning of heavy duty equipment, is needed.
Find below tips for heavy duty gym equipment maintenance:
- Maintain a regular cleaning program
- Follow the manuals to get proper maintenance tips
- Lubricate moving parts of the gym machines
- Disinfecting the gym equipment regularly

Selecting Freight Forwarding Company
Freight forwarding companies support in-house goods to your warehouse or near your destination to a port.
Some manufacturers or suppliers have their freight forwarding service, which is marginally cost-saving. You can get delivery from the manufacturer directly to your destination, which is a less costly way to import.
Another common way is to contact the freight forwarders responsible for delivering the goods to your warehouse with all customs clearance issues. This is a bit more costly, but they are more professional and specialized in import/export.

Can you get heavy duty equipment for a lease?
Yes, it is common to lease heavy duty gym equipment for commercial setups.
Gym owners may find investment shortage to purchase heavy duty equipment. So, they might go after leasing gym equipment.
But, in the long run, it is less wise to lease than to buy. Leasing needs monthly instalments to pay, this requires making down payments and more to pay than the actual price.
Leasing, in a sense, is a better option, whereas tuning, repairing, and maintenance is the leasing company’s responsibility.
